RLI annual/quarterly income from continuous operations history and growth rate from 2010 to 2025. Income from continuous operations can be defined as a company's total income or loss before discontinued operations, extraordinary items, preferred stock dividends and accounting change
  • RLI income from continuous operations for the quarter ending June 30, 2025 was $0.124B, a 51.64% increase year-over-year.
  • RLI income from continuous operations for the twelve months ending June 30, 2025 was $0.323B, a 4.32% decline year-over-year.
  • RLI annual income from continuous operations for 2024 was $0.346B, a 13.51% increase from 2023.
  • RLI annual income from continuous operations for 2023 was $0.305B, a 47.79% decline from 2022.
  • RLI annual income from continuous operations for 2022 was $0.583B, a 108.84% increase from 2021.

RLI Corp. is a specialty property-casualty underwriter that caters primarily to niche markets through its main operating subsidiary, RLI Insurance Company. Other subsidiaries include Mt. Hawley Insurance Company and RLI Indemnity Company. RLI Corp. classifies its operations into three distinct segments - Casualty, Property, and Surety. Casualty segment comprises general liability, personal umbrella, transportation, executive products, commercial umbrella, multi-peril program business, and other specialty coverage. Property segment provides commercial property coverage, including excess and surplus lines and specialty insurance such as fire, earthquake, flood and inland marine. Surety segment specializes in writing small-to-large commercial and small contract surety coverage, as well as those for the energy , petrochemical and refining industries. RLI Corp. distributes its products through branch offices to wholesale and retail brokers, independent agents and e-commerce channels.
